What companies run services between Waterloo Station, England and Merchant Taylors' Hall, City of York, England?

London North Eastern Railway Limited (LNER) operates a train from King's Cross to York every 30 minutes. Tickets cost £65–90 and the journey takes 1h 45m. Grand Central Trains also services this route every 4 hours.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Waterloo Station / York Road to Merchant Taylors' Hall via Victoria Coach Station, London Victoria, Leeds City Bus Station, and Stonebow in around 7h 1m.
